    Jennifer from PA Asked Please note that experiences, policies, pricing and other offerings are subject to change and may have changed since the date of this answer.

    Is it still possible to re-enter a park that you had a reservation for later that same day now that there is park-hopping? Reservation for MK and leave to go to the Contemporary for a meal, will we run a risk of not being able to get back into MK?

    One of my favorite parts of being a planDisney panelist, Jennifer, is when I get the chance to share great news with Guests just like you! Thanks for giving me another opportunity to do that today.

    Indeed, Guests who have theme park reservations are permitted to leave the park and return later during operating hours on the same day. Your reservation acts as a placeholder and makes sure there is space for you to enter, even after a break. It’s not at all uncommon for Guests to spend a morning enjoying attractions at the park and then take a midday break. I love that the park reservation allows those savvy Guests the assurance that they can return later for more fun in the evening.
